Using Diclofenac Sodium Topical Gel 1%?

I bought this product to use on my shoulder, arthritic pain. The flyer says it should not be used on the shoulder, why is that. The pain is in my shoulder and down my arm into my elbow. The pain wakes me frequently during the night, it is a deep ache. If I can't use this on my shoulder what can I use?

You can use diclofenac gel on the shoulder. If it doesn't work, you can try prescription dmso 70% with decadron 1%. I make it up in my office.
I have had patients use it on the neck and shoulders without difficulty, but safer substances that might be helpful are CBD oil, DMSO, essential oils like Frankincense and/or lavender. I would also recommend you see your physician as you may have a joint problem that needs to be addressed.
